Goran Petrovic

Angestellt, Senior Software Engineer, Zurich Insurance Company Ltd
Dublin, Irland

Fähigkeiten und Kenntnisse

design patterns
software design
Java
J2EE
Android
Spring
Hibernate
Web services
Scrum
ITIL
JMS
JavaScript
Mockito
Maven
JSF
WebServices
Mulesoft

Werdegang

Berufserfahrung von Goran Petrovic

  • Bis heute 8 Jahre und 7 Monate, seit Jan. 2017

    Senior Software Engineer

    Zurich Insurance Company Ltd

    Currently working on Retail Transformation Project to provide innovative, shared and reusable platforms and services to expand various sales channels and unable growth.Development of various Web services to enable and ensure centralization of enterprise capabilities, and also act as a conduit for seamless integration between heterogeneous systems deployed on cloud and on-premise, within and outside Zurich Insurance.

  • 1 Jahr und 11 Monate, März 2015 - Jan. 2017

    Senior Software Engineer

    Dimension Data Europe

    Development of sophisticated cloud management system that provides complete automation of the orchestration, administration, provisioning, management, support, metering and billing of cloud-based resources. Product is based on multi-tier architecture and communication between its different modules is done through JMS, SOAP and Rest APIs. Design and development of APIs consumed by various client applications.

  • 4 Jahre und 3 Monate, Jan. 2011 - März 2015

    Senior Software Engineer

    APIS IT

    Involved in design and development of various software components using design patterns and test driven development. For improvement of development processes, I have used Jenkins for continuous integration and Sonar for test coverage reports. Estimating, delegating and ensuring project objectives are met by helping the team to communicate effectively, agree on goals, and deal with anything that obstructs progress.

  • 3 Monate, Apr. 2014 - Juni 2014

    Android Software Engineer

    SimpleSource

    I implemented a backend part of statistics and voting mobile application for World Cup Brazil 2014 using Android SDK. Application is synchronizing data with RESTful web service using JSON and storing data in local database using greenDao ORM framework. Exception handling and customer usage tracking is implemented using Crittercism. Application is built, tested and packaged using Gradle.

  • 3 Jahre und 5 Monate, Sep. 2007 - Jan. 2011

    Software Engineer

    APIS IT

    Participated in the development of a business rules execution engine to perform complex validation and routing of goods passed through the national customs system. Designed and developed user interface for Websphere Portal application using portlet specification. Implementation of reporting service that generates various documents using Jasper Reports library.

  • 7 Monate, März 2007 - Sep. 2007

    QA and test automation

    APIS IT

    Defining the scope and objectives of various levels of QA testing. Involved in defining, developing, executing and documenting automated test plans and test cases. Development of automated test scripts with a variety of testing tools such as: IBM Functional Tester, IBM Performance Tester, SoapUI, Sellenium.

Ausbildung von Goran Petrovic

  • Software Engineering

    University College for Applied Computer Engineering

Sprachen

  • Englisch

    Fließend

  • Croatian

    -

XING – Das Jobs-Netzwerk

  • Über eine Million Jobs

    Entdecke mit XING genau den Job, der wirklich zu Dir passt.

  • Persönliche Job-Angebote

    Lass Dich finden von Arbeitgebern und über 20.000 Recruiter·innen.

  • 22 Mio. Mitglieder

    Knüpf neue Kontakte und erhalte Impulse für ein besseres Job-Leben.

  • Kostenlos profitieren

    Schon als Basis-Mitglied kannst Du Deine Job-Suche deutlich optimieren.

21 Mio. XING Mitglieder, von A bis Z